Output 3d17403eb624ee350090ea6d9c7e459de94317373a7f9ed5477bdacf2d47077e:1

value
17710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ff2afd7807935dd12297bb26c354185ef663cc OP_EQUAL
address
3KU4h8vfF9g3v51KafLc7Pe3homLfEE2cG
transaction
3d17403eb624ee350090ea6d9c7e459de94317373a7f9ed5477bdacf2d47077e
spent
true